2018 Senate Bill 915 / Public Act 273

Cap maximum school bus width

Introduced in the Senate

March 21, 2018

Introduced by Sen. Tom Casperson (R-38)

To cap the maximum width of school buses at 102 inches, which is the same as for trailer coaches, trailers, semitrailers, truck campers and motor homes. Also, to exempt school buses from seasonal road weight restrictions.
